Not bright at all.
I purchased these stars for my 18 month old, his sister also has glow in the dark stars in her room and he absolutely loves them. They looked well done, I loved the double stick idea (adhesive and putty), and placing them on his wall was a breeze. That being said, there's next to no glow. I saturate the room in light regularly, I leave the blinds open and let daylight in throughout the day, I followed the directions and placed them under a lamp for three minutes to activate them... Yet, it's our third day with the stars up and there's nothing coming off of them. They should be recharging, yet they are not. I'll try a last ditch effort of shining a flashlight on them and leaving his light on for a while, but at this point, if the massive amounts of sunshine that come in during the day don't do the trick, I don't think three minutes of light from a flashlight is going to change much either. Beautiful idea, just didn't pan out for us.

Stars Glow Pretty Quickly - Adhesive Backing Gives Dual Use
We bought these Glow in the Dark Stars to be used in a completely different way. My son, 7, is in a Kindness Club and likes to give out things at events. We are in the midst of a 4 night event called Blink here in Cincinnati. Projection mapped lights on buildings or on structures and murals ( some with sychronized music). Everything glows, we decided to use the Glow in the Dark Stars as a type of medium, but with the concept of Kindness Rocks (much lighter and easier to transport). With the adhesive backing on these, it makes them wearable for the recipient (if they choose to do so). We used permanent markers to write on them, some colors allow the glow to come thru completely (light blue, while yellow does not).
